Rock the Capitals- South America

Thanks! Share it with your friends!

You disliked this video. Thanks for the feedback!

Added by MiAmigo
189 Views
Rock the Capitals song for South America. Yes, not all South American countries are listed and yes Brazil speaks Portuguese and not Spanish. These were the countries listed in the curriculum.
Category
Best Rock Songs
Commenting disabled.